- Farmer's Markets:
Balloch, Loch Lomond Shores First and third
Sundays of each month.
Featuring around 30 regular stallholders
ranging from cheese and chocolate makers
through to producers of organic eggs, beef,
lamb, pork, home made soup, smoked foods,
seafood, jams, confectionery and home
baking.
